Cryptocurrency Markets Face Sharp Decline Amid Rising Geopolitical Tensions

Bitcoin Drops Below $75,000 as Ethereum, XRP, and Dogecoin Experience Significant Losses

Cryptocurrency markets have experienced a notable downturn in response to increasing geopolitical tensions tied to ongoing nuclear negotiations between Iran and the United States. Bitcoin, the leading digital asset, saw its price decline sharply by approximately 6% within a single day, falling below a key psychological threshold of $75,000 to trade at around $74,791.94.

This decline is mirrored across several major cryptocurrencies. Ethereum, the second-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ization, slipped to a price near $2,183.51. Other digital assets including Solana, XRP, Dogecoin, and Shiba Inu also registered significant losses, with Solana trading near $99.13, XRP at $1.57, Dogecoin at approximately $0.1053, and Shiba Inu at $0.056706.

Market Impact and Trader Liquidations

Data from Coinglass indicates that in the previous 24 hours, a substantial number of traders faced liquidations, totaling 156,179 individuals with losses amounting to around $630.76 million. This figure underscores the heightened volatility and risk associated with leveraged positions amid current market conditions.

Notably, lesser-known cryptocurrencies such as Canton, Dash, and Optimism have been among the steepest decliners recently, compounding the broader market's downward momentum.

Trader Sentiment and Technical Analysis

Market observers point to significant technical levels that will influence near-term price trajectories. Jacob Canfield, a widely followed trader, notes Bitcoin has entered a critical liquidity zone without showing signs of a meaningful price rebound, indicating elevated risks of further decline. Given thin liquidity and soaring short-term volatility, he advises caution for those engaging in leverage trading, recommending spot accumulation as a safer alternative.

Canfield emphasizes the importance of the upcoming weekly closing price. A strong recovery and sustained price above $75,000 would be viewed positively, whereas failure to maintain this level could expose Bitcoin to a deeper correction toward a key Fibonacci retracement level near $58,000.

Additional observations by Altcoin Sherpa mark the $67,000 price area as a significant buy zone if Bitcoin continues downward, aligning with the 200-week exponential moving average, which historically provides support.

Crypto analyst Jelle highlights that Bitcoin has broken essential market structure thresholds, including on intra-day wick levels. The recent lower closing price serves to confirm this breakdown, signaling a loss of bullish momentum. He notes that, at present, the primary avenue for bulls to regain control would be through a liquidity sweep, implying persistent downside risk remains dominant.
